One of the greatest concerns with recycling solar panels is the intricacy of the job itself. It can be difficult to break down the different elements, such as glass and steel, to be reused individually. Additionally, solar panel producers often have a mix of materials utilized in their items that makes arranging them even more complex. Moreover, there are security and health threats involved with handling broken glass or inhaling fumes from melting parts.

To start with, several business have carried out a 'take-back' system where old or damaged solar panels can be collected and sent to their respective manufacturing facilities for reusing. By doing this, the products have the ability to be recycled in the building and construction of new items. Additionally, some towns have actually also started supplying rewards for people wishing to recycle their photovoltaic panels; this could range from tax obligation breaks to totally free delivery expenses.

Furthermore, technology has actually become progressively innovative when it pertains to reusing photovoltaic panels-- with specialized equipments capable of separating out all the various elements within them. As an example, by using AI-powered robot arms, these machines can remove useful products such as copper and aluminium while additionally throwing away hazardous waste securely.
